Masonry Wall Painting in Boulder, CO
Masonry wall painting services involve applying high-quality paint or protective coatings to existing brick, stone, or concrete walls to enhance their appearance and durability. This service is often requested for projects such as updating exterior facades, restoring aged or weathered masonry surfaces, or preparing walls for ongoing protection against the elements. Homeowners typically want to understand the types of finishes available, the preparation process needed for a smooth application, and how the chosen coatings can improve the longevity and aesthetic appeal of their masonry structures.
Before requesting masonry wall painting, property owners should consider the current condition of the surfaces, including any cracks, peeling paint, or moisture issues that may need addressing beforehand. It’s also helpful to understand the best type of paint or coating for the specific material, whether it’s brick, stone, or concrete, and how weather conditions in the area might influence the choice of finish. Proper surface preparation and selecting appropriate materials are key factors in achieving a long-lasting, attractive result.

Masonry Wall Painting Questions
What types of masonry walls can be painted? Masonry wall painting services typically include concrete, brick, stone, and block walls to enhance appearance and protect surfaces.
How does painting masonry walls benefit property owners? Applying paint can improve curb appeal, provide weather resistance, and help prevent damage from moisture and environmental elements.
Are special preparations needed before painting a masonry wall? Surface cleaning, repairing cracks, and applying primer are common steps to ensure proper adhesion and a long-lasting finish.
What colors and finishes are available for masonry wall painting? A variety of colors and finishes, such as matte or satin, are available to match different aesthetic preferences and property styles.
